Oliver Ollesch Named GSC Track Athlete of the Year

CLINTON, Miss. — Mississippi College standout Oliver Ollesch has been named the 2025 Gulf South Conference Men's Track Athlete of the Year, the league office announced Tuesday afternoon. The honor, voted on by the conference's head coaches, marks the second consecutive year a Choctaw has earned the award—joining Nik Klei, who received the honor in 2024. It is also just the second time a Mississippi College athlete has claimed the award since the program was reinstated into GSC competition in 2016.

Ollesch delivered a dominant outdoor season for the Choctaws, capping it off with three podium finishes at the 2025 GSC Outdoor Track & Field Championships. He captured gold and broke the GSC record in the 400-meter hurdles and anchored MC's championship-winning 4x400-meter relay team. He also helped the Choctaws secure a third-place finish in the 4x100 relay, showcasing his range and consistency across multiple events.

The senior hurdler has steadily emerged as one of the GSC's elite competitors throughout his career and solidified that status in 2025 with multiple top finishes against the conference's best. His performance helped MC maintain its competitive presence on the track and in relays, playing a crucial role in the Choctaws' strong showing at the GSC Championships.

Ollesch's selection adds another milestone to what has been a historic season for the Mississippi College track and field program and further underscores the program's growth on the conference and regional stage.

The GSC also recognized UAH's Malik Turner as the Field Athlete of the Year, Lee's Pierre Chauveau as Freshman of the Year, and UAH head coach David Cain as Coach of the Year.

2025 GSC Men's Outdoor Track & Field Award Winners

  • Track Athlete of the Year: Oliver Ollesch, Mississippi College

  • Field Athlete of the Year: Malik Turner, UAH

  • Freshman of the Year: Pierre Chauveau, Lee

  • Coach of the Year: David Cain, UAH

Ollesch and the Choctaws now shift focus toward postseason competition, where they aim to carry momentum into the NCAA Nationals in Pueblo, CO.
